It is over forty-five years since I first read this novel and its sentiment still rings true today. Bearing in mind this book was first published in 1931 it is no wonder that some of the "predictions" appear quaint, or sometimes outlandish. This is not a science-fiction story it is about how, in a future world, the State controls its citizens. The "predictions" are secondary to the plot.The story is set in the twenty-sixth century in a world free from War, Famine, Disease, Poverty and everybody has a job, but this comes at a price. The State controls your every move from even before you are born! It pre-determines your status and then after birth conditions each citizen to faithfully execute their designated job. In this society everybody is happy not least because the State provides all with drugs to ameliorate loneliness and unhappiness. There is no unrest unless the state sponsored drug supply is interrupted. In other words carefree happiness is guaranteed if you do as you are told.Transplanted into this Brave New World is a man born outside this idyll. This man is unfettered by conditioning, or technology, and is known as "The Savage". His raw human emotions are unable to comprehend the modern morality. The thrust of the novel is about how he tries to reconcile these differences.Although well written this story is not all easy reading. It breaks down taboos , such as sex and death, and turns the standards of the nineteenth century on its head. However, it is thought provoking. I don't think the author fully answers all the questions he raises, but leaves it up to the reader. Is that not the sign of a good read?
